<ns3:p>Background: Depression and anxiety are among the most prevalent mental health disorders globally; however, access to traditional therapy remains limited due to barriers such as cost, geographic constraints, and stigma. Digital mental health interventions (DMHIs), including internet-based cognitive behavioral therapy (iCBT), mobile applications, chatbots, and virtual reality (VR), have emerged as promising alternatives or complements to conventional care.Aim of the study: This review aims to evaluate the effectiveness, advantages, limitations, and future prospects of various digital interventions for depression and anxiety, as well as to discuss their integration into healthcare systems.Material and methods: A comprehensive literature review was conducted, focusing on randomized controlled trials, meta-analyses, and systematic reviews addressing digital interventions for depression and anxiety. The analysis included the efficacy of iCBT, mobile health applications, AI-based chatbots, and VR-based therapies, along with challenges such as adherence, data quality, and personalization.Results: iCBT consistently demonstrates clinical outcomes comparable to those of traditional face-to-face therapy, particularly when guided by a clinician. Mobile applications and chatbots show potential for short-term symptom reduction, especially among younger populations; however, they suffer from variable quality and high dropout rates. VR interventions are effective in exposure therapy, particularly for anxiety disorders, but face barriers including cost and limited accessibility. Hybrid models combining digital tools with professional support enhance adherence and treatment outcomes. Key challenges include user engagement, privacy concerns, and the need for standardization and cultural adaptation.Conclusions: Digital mental health interventions represent valuable complementary tools to traditional therapy, offering increased accessibility and flexibility. Future efforts should focus on improving personalization, regulatory oversight, and integration within healthcare systems to optimize their clinical impact.</ns3:p>
